Global Basin Rehabilitation Equipment Market size was valued at USD 1.97 Billion in 2024 and is poised to grow from USD 2.15 Billion in 2025 to USD 4.38 Billion by 2033, growing at a CAGR of 9.3% during the forecast period (2026-2033).
The global basin rehabilitation equipment market is experiencing steady growth, largely driven by an increasing demand for restored water basins, reservoirs, and irrigation systems. Heightened awareness of water conservation issues, coupled with the preservation of aging infrastructure to mitigate water loss from leaks or deterioration, is fueling this trend. Key solutions encompass advanced technologies for cleaning, repairing, lining, and reinforcing basins, enhancing operational efficiency, and extending their lifespan. Demand is particularly robust in agricultural regions, where revitalizing basins is essential for ensuring effective irrigation flow and minimizing water usage. Investment by government and private sectors in rehabilitation initiatives, aimed at sustainable water management and climate adaptation, is rising as well. Innovations in monitoring and automation are further enhancing precision, reducing downtime, and cutting operational costs, making modern solutions more attractive and profitable for end-users.

Global Basin Rehabilitation Equipment Market Segments Analysis
Global Basin Rehabilitation Equipment Market is segmented by Equipment Type, Application Area, End User Industry, Power Source, Size of Equipment and region. Based on Equipment Type, the market is segmented into Excavators, Bulldozers, Graders, Backhoes, Hydraulic Pumps, Drilling Machines and Compactors. Based on Application Area, the market is segmented into Flood Control, Soil Erosion Control, Landscape Restoration, Aquatic Habitat Restoration, Civil Engineering Projects and Agricultural Land Rehabilitation. Based on End User Industry, the market is segmented into Construction, Agriculture, Mining, Water Management, Environmental Services and Government and Public Sector. Based on Power Source, the market is segmented into Electric, Diesel, Hybrid and Solar-powered. Based on Size of Equipment, the market is segmented into Small Equipment, Medium Equipment and Large Equipment. Based on region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& Africa.
Driver of the Global Basin Rehabilitation Equipment Market
One of the key market drivers for the Global Basin Rehabilitation Equipment Market is the increasing emphasis on environmental sustainability and the restoration of natural habitats. As industrialization and urbanization continue to exert pressure on ecosystems, governments and organizations are prioritizing initiatives to rehabilitate and restore degraded landscapes, wetlands, and water bodies. This shift towards eco-friendly practices is fueling demand for advanced rehabilitation equipment designed to efficiently manage sediment control, vegetation restoration, and habitat enhancement. Additionally, growing awareness of climate change and the need for effective disaster management are further driving investments in rehabilitation technologies, propelling market growth.
Restraints in the Global Basin Rehabilitation Equipment Market
One significant market restraint for the global basin rehabilitation equipment market is the high initial investment cost associated with advanced rehabilitation technologies. Many potential users, particularly in developing regions, may face financial barriers to purchasing and maintaining sophisticated equipment. Additionally, the lack of awareness and technical expertise to operate these advanced tools can hinder adoption, leading to underutilization and reluctance among stakeholders. Regulatory challenges and varying environmental standards across different regions further complicate the market landscape, restricting access and increasing compliance costs for manufacturers and service providers, ultimately limiting market growth.
Market Trends of the Global Basin Rehabilitation Equipment Market
The Global Basin Rehabilitation Equipment market is witnessing a notable shift towards the integration of artificial intelligence (AI), the Internet of Things (IoT), and advanced smart monitoring technologies. This trend is enhancing the efficiency and effectiveness of rehabilitation systems by enabling real-time condition monitoring, predictive maintenance scheduling, and early detection of structural issues. As a result, organizations are experiencing reduced machinery downtime and lower operational costs. This technological evolution not only improves resource management but also supports sustainable practices, driving a more proactive approach in basin rehabilitation efforts across various sectors, positioning businesses to thrive in a competitive landscape.
